WebOct 12, 2024 · Since this recipe is a quick pickled vegetable, not processed and canned, it is not shelf-stable and must be stored in the refrigerator. While the pickled cabbage won't last as long if it were canned, it will keep for up to 2 weeks in your refrigerator if stored in an airtight container.
